#4aefd5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4aefd5 is composed of 29% red, 93.7%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69% cyan, 0% magenta, 10.9%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 170.5 degrees, a saturation of 83.8% and a lightness of 61.4%. #4aefd5 color hex could be obtained by blending #94ffff with #00dfab.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

#4aefd5 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4aefd5 has RGB values of R:74, G:239, B:213 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.11,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 4911061.

Hex triplet 4aefd5 #4aefd5
RGB Decimal 74, 239, 213 rgb(74,239,213)
RGB Percent 29, 93.7, 83.5 rgb(29%,93.7%,83.5%)
CMYK 69, 0, 11, 6
HSL 170.5°, 83.8, 61.4 hsl(170.5,83.8%,61.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 170.5°, 69, 93.7
Web Safe 33ffcc #33ffcc
CIE-LAB 86.001, -47.96, 0.29
XYZ 45.697, 67.989, 73.662
xyY 0.244, 0.363, 67.989
CIE-LCH 86.001, 47.961, 179.653
CIE-LUV 86.001, -62.341, 8.149
Hunter-Lab 82.455, -45.372, 4.752
Binary 01001010, 11101111, 11010101

Shades and Tints of #4aefd5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02110f is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4aefd5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#96a3a1 is the less saturated color, while #3bfedf is the most saturated one.
